What to Expect: Understanding Aetna Plan Costs

When exploring Aetna Medicare Advantage plans, you'll find that premiums can range from $0 to over $100 per month, depending on your chosen plan and location.

Out-of-pocket costs, including copayments and deductibles, vary but typically cap at around $7,550 annually.

Coverage and benefits often include prescription drugs, dental, vision, and hearing, providing extensive care tailored to your needs.

Premiums and Out-of-Pocket

Managing the costs of Aetna Medicare Advantage plans involves understanding both premiums and out-of-pocket expenses. You'll notice premium variations depending on the specific plan and location. Some plans may offer $0 premiums, but they often come with higher out-of-pocket expenses.

It's essential to compare these elements to find what suits your budget.

Out-of-pocket expenses include copayments, coinsurance, and deductibles. The annual out-of-pocket maximum caps your spending, protecting you from unexpected costs.

For instance, if you frequently visit specialists, consider plans with lower copayments even if the premiums are slightly higher. Analyzing these factors helps you anticipate your total healthcare spending more accurately, ensuring you select a plan that aligns with both your financial and healthcare needs.

Finding Your Doctors: Aetna's Network Flexibility

Maneuvering Aetna's network flexibility is vital for ensuring you can access the healthcare providers you prefer. Aetna offers extensive network accessibility, allowing you to select physicians from a broad list of in-network providers.

With over 1.2 million healthcare professionals and 5,700 hospitals, your options for physician selection are vast. Aetna's plans are designed to accommodate your needs, letting you choose specialists without requiring referrals, which enhances your control over healthcare decisions.

Evaluating Aetna's network directory is essential. It helps you confirm whether your current doctors are part of the network, ensuring continuity of care.

Access to your preferred physicians depends on plan type, so reviewing the specific plan details is key for ideal physician selection and seamless healthcare access.

Prescription Drug Coverage With Aetna: Key Points

When considering prescription drug coverage with Aetna, it’s crucial to examine the key components that define their offerings. Aetna's plans often include extensive drug formularies, which list covered medications.

These formularies are structured into coverage tiers, affecting your copayments and out-of-pocket costs. Typically, generic drugs fall into lower tiers, offering more affordable options, while brand-name and specialty drugs are in higher tiers.

  • Drug Formularies: Aetna provides a detailed list of covered medications, ensuring you know what's included.
  • Coverage Tiers: Different tiers determine the cost of your prescriptions, with lower tiers generally being more cost-effective.
  • Cost Management: Aetna's tier system helps manage expenses by categorizing drugs based on price and necessity.
  • Updates: Formularies are regularly updated to reflect changes in drug availability and pricing.

Steps to Enroll in Aetna Medicare Advantage

With a focus on keeping customers satisfied, understanding the steps to enroll in Aetna Medicare Advantage guarantees you make informed decisions.

First, confirm your eligibility criteria, including age and existing Medicare Part A and B coverage. Knowing the enrollment timeline is essential; the Initial Enrollment Period (IEP) starts three months before your 65th birthday and lasts seven months. During this time, you can enroll without penalties.

  • Check Eligibility: Verify you meet age and Medicare requirements.
  • Understand Enrollment Timeline: Be aware of the IEP and other enrollment periods.
  • Research Plans: Compare plans based on your healthcare needs and budget.
  • Complete Enrollment: Apply online, by phone, or through a licensed agent.

Following these steps guarantees a smooth enrollment process.

Can I Switch From Aetna to Another Provider Easily?

Yes, you can switch from Aetna to another provider during specific periods, like the Annual Enrollment Period.

Compare Aetna provider options with others to guarantee the best fit. Understand switching timelines, as changes usually take effect in January.

Evaluate plan benefits, costs, and networks objectively to make an informed decision. Keep data handy to assist in a smooth changeover, confirming your new plan meets your healthcare needs.

Are There Any Hidden Fees in Aetna Plans?

You won’t typically find hidden costs in Aetna plans, but it’s essential to review the plan details thoroughly.

Sometimes, additional expenses arise from premium increases or specific services not fully covered. Check co-pays, deductibles, and out-of-network charges. Always compare these with other providers to guarantee you’re getting the best value.

Reviewing the annual notice of changes is key to understanding any potential premium shifts or cost adjustments.

How Does Aetna Handle Disputes or Grievances?

Aetna manages disputes through a structured dispute resolution process. You can start with their grievance process, where you submit your complaint in writing or by phone.

They’ll notify you within ten days and aim to resolve it within 30 days. If unsatisfied, you can escalate to an external review.

They adhere to regulatory timelines and provide detailed responses, ensuring transparency and compliance in handling your concerns efficiently.
